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Boiled Celery vs Boiled Swiss Chard:
Boiled and Drained Celery has 1.9 times more Vitamin B5 and 3.7 times more Vitamin B9 than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ard.
While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ard contain 11.8 times more Vitamin A, 1.5 times more Vitamin B1, 3 times more Vitamin C, 5.4 times more Vitamin E and 8.7 times more Vitamin K than Boiled and Drained Celery.
Both Boiled and Drained Celery and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ard have similar amounts of Vitamin B2, Vitamin B3 and Vitamin B6 per 100 g.
Both Boiled and Drained Celery as well as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 100 g.
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Boiled Celery vs Boiled Swiss Chard:
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ard contain 1.4 times more Calcium, 4.5 times more Copper, 5.4 times more Iron, 7.2 times more Magnesium, 3.2 times more Manganese, 1.3 times more Phosphorus, 1.9 times more Potassium, 2 times more Sodium and 2.4 times more Zinc than Boiled and Drained Celery.
Both Boiled and Drained Celery and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ard have similar amounts of Selenium and Water per 100 g.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
Boiled and Drained Celery has 2.2 times more Sugars than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ard.
While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ard contain 1.3 times more Fiber and 2.3 times more Protein than Boiled and Drained Celery.
Both Boiled and Drained Celery and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ard have similar amounts of Carbohydrate per 100 g.
Both Boiled and Drained Celery as well as Boiled and Drained Swiss Chard have insufficient amounts of Energy, Fat, Omega 3, Omega 6, Cholesterol, Glucose and Sucrose in 100 g.
